The compound 9-oxo-2-phenoxy-1,3,8,10-tetraaza-2λ5-phosphatricyclo[8.4.0.03,8]tetradecane-2-sulfide, C15H21N4O2PS, was synthesized from bis(hexahydropyridazido)thiophosphoric acid O-phenyl ester and bis(trichloromethyl)carbonate(trisphosgene) in the presence of triethylamine. The molecular structure of the tricyclic system consists of a central six-membered ring with a twist conformation, the two anellated hexahydropyridazine rings revealing 'normal' chair conformations. Bond distances: N-N 1.429 (3) and 1.420 (3) Å, P-N 1.647 (2) and 1.663 (2) Å, P-S 1.913 (1) Å.
